When it comes to capturing the right kind of prospect for your website, most of the companies have no idea how to do it. They often select the wrong platform and end up in noconversi­on. Google is smart enough to figure out the needs of marketing to reach out to new and existing audience.

Google Display Network is known for reaching out to 90% of the worldwide internet users with 2 million sites. GDN is a subordinat­e of Google AdWords which helps the business to reach out to the right kind of audience, at the right place, and at the right time. With Google Display Network, you can place your ad, whether image, video or simply text on the relevant websites. So, the ad would only be seen by the relevant audience. For example – an offer on baby diapers will be showcased to audience discussing or reading about diapering needs. The interested people will click on it and land on the website.

Sign-up for Google adwords & get started!

Creating an account for Google AdWords doesn’t cost you a penny because it is absolutely free. You can simply sign up with Google AdWords. Create GDN aka Google Display Network campaigns. Run ads, measure the results, and optimise the performanc­e accordingl­y. AdWords charges you either for every click or per 1000 impression­s, based on the CPC or CPM model respective­ly.

Benefits over other platforms

Google AdWords gives you the upper hand when it comes to the perks of using GDN. Primarily, it gives you control over the placements or websites you wish to showcase your ad on.You can select the regions where you wish to run the ads. Scheduling of ad could be done as well. For instance, you can select the time slot in which you wish to run your ads.

There is no fixed or minimum budget for running ads on Google. You can run ads for as low as ₹100 a day. Once the ad is live, the payment is billed with the number of clicks. If there are no clicks, no amount would be billed.

Targeting a specific set of audience

You can further enrich your target by identifyin­g which set of audience you wish to capture. There are several parameters on the basis of which one can filter the audience. 1. Interest: Placing ads by predefined interest categories of the audience which are gathered fromtheir browsing history is tapping the audience based on interest. For example, if you regularly visit any tech related website or a blog that features technology updates, then you are likely to be placed under Technology Interest category. Topical: Targeting the users based on topic categories is Topical Targeting. For example, sports, news, food, entertainm­ent, health, parenting, etc. 3. Contextual targeting via Keywords: Using keywords to find the relevant webpages for your ads is referred to Contextual Targeting.
